If you got an OG less than 14 days ago (which means you could exchange it for free if you brick) and wouldn't mind bricking, I have something kind of risky for you to try. This could potentially make us able to run nexus 4 kernels, which would make the road to CM exponentially shorter. If you are interested, please PM me or post here and I will send you the necessary files. If possible, I would like someone who knows how to use fastboot. This is completely voluntary, so do not get mad at me if your phone bricks. Sorry to ask this of you, but my 14 days ended. My idea is to flash the RPM partition from the Canadian E973, which has CM and can run n4 kernels. The nexus 4 RPM led to a brick unless someone flashed their partition map (in which case, it worked and accomplished the intended goal), since the OG's and N4's partition maps are very different, but the Canadian OG's is mostly the same, which leads me to believe it could work.

Warranty yes, insurance no. Rooting voids your warranty, not your insurance. Insurance covers physical damage, so if you hard brick your phone, just to be safe you "accidentally" dropped it in the bathtub.

Just read, read, read. Then read some more. Make sure you fully understand every possible thing that can go wrong (I.e. Losing imei) and how to fix it. If you know what can happen, and how it happens, you will know how to avoid those things. Never have the "I will cross that bridge when I get there" attitude. Almost everything that can go wrong is 100% preventable/curable if you know about it ahead of time. If you don't feel like you can explain to someone else how to root or fix their phone, you're not ready yet.
